1. Marketplace
Marketplace is one of the most respected business news podcasts, offering daily coverage of economics, business trends, and financial markets in an engaging and accessible style.
Why listeners enjoy it:
- Easy-to-understand economic reporting
- Coverage of global business events
- Personal finance insights
- Technology updates
- Interviews with industry experts
Rather than overwhelming listeners with technical financial jargon, Marketplace explains how major economic events affect businesses and everyday consumers.
Episodes are concise, informative, and ideal for professionals looking to stay informed during their commute or morning routine.
2. The Journal
Produced by The Wall Street Journal, The Journal explores one major business story each weekday through detailed reporting and expert interviews.
Highlights include:
- Corporate news
- Financial markets
- Technology companies
- Economic policy
- Global business developments
Each episode provides context behind the headlines instead of simply reporting the news, making it an excellent choice for listeners who want deeper analysis.
The storytelling approach keeps complex business topics engaging while helping listeners understand how major events influence industries around the world.

7. FT News Briefing
Produced by the Financial Times, FT News Briefing delivers concise daily summaries of the biggest business and financial stories from around the world.
Listeners can expect coverage of:
- Global markets
- International business
- Corporate mergers
- Economic policy
- Banking industry
- Technology and innovation
Episodes typically last around 10–15 minutes, making them ideal for busy professionals who want a quick overview before starting work.
The podcast is particularly valuable for entrepreneurs with international interests, as it covers business developments across Europe, North America, Asia, and emerging markets.
8. Planet Money
Planet Money takes a unique approach by explaining economics through engaging stories and real-life examples.
Regular themes include:
- Inflation
- Supply chains
- Trade
- Consumer behaviour
- Entrepreneurship
- Global markets
Rather than overwhelming listeners with statistics, the hosts simplify complicated economic concepts into entertaining episodes that anyone can understand.
Business owners often appreciate Planet Money because it helps explain the economic forces affecting pricing, customer demand, hiring, and investment decisions.
Its storytelling style makes learning about business both educational and enjoyable.
9. Business Wars
Unlike traditional news podcasts, Business Wars explores the competitive battles between some of the world’s biggest companies.
Popular topics include:
- Apple vs Samsung
- Nike vs Adidas
- Netflix vs Blockbuster
- Uber vs Lyft
- Coca-Cola vs Pepsi
These stories offer valuable lessons in marketing, branding, innovation, pricing, and competitive strategy.
Entrepreneurs can learn how successful companies adapt to market changes, respond to competition, and build lasting customer loyalty.
Although it isn’t a daily news show, Business Wars provides timeless business insights that complement your daily news podcasts.
10. The Indicator from Planet Money
The Indicator is perfect for listeners who want fast, digestible business updates.
Each episode usually lasts less than 10 minutes while covering topics like:
- Employment
- Inflation
- Small business
- Investing
- Consumer spending
- Economic policy
Its short format makes it easy to stay informed without committing to lengthy listening sessions.
The hosts present complex business topics in a friendly, conversational style, making it an excellent choice for beginners and experienced professionals alike.
